matlab取整函数(matlab中的取整函数)
本篇文章给大家谈谈matlab取整函数,以及matlab中的取整函数对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
matlab中的floor是什么意思
matlab中的floor意思是“向下取整”,即取不大于x的最大整数,与“四舍五入”不同,下取整直接取按照数轴上山唤最接近要求值的左边值,即不逗前凯大于要求值的最大的那个整数值。语法为FLOOR(number, significance),Number是要舍入的数值。Significance是要舍入到的倍数。
扩展资料:
FLOOR 对于复数,分别对实部和虚部取整。原型是function floor(x:float):integer。当x大于integer的范围时会引发溢出错误。
如果任一参数为非数值型,则 FLOOR 将返回错误值 #VALUE!。如果 number 的符号为正,significance 的符号为负,则 FLOOR 将返回错误值 #NUM!。
如果 number 的符号为正,函数值会向靠近零的方向舍入。如果 number 的符号为负,函数值会向远离零的方向舍入。如果 number 恰好是 significance 的整数倍,则不悔誉进行舍入。
[img]matlab中小数如何取整?
matlab中小数取整的函数大约有四个态庆:floor、ceil、round、fix
若
A
=
[-2.0,
-1.9,
-1.55,
-1.45,
-1.1,
1.0,
1.1,
1.45,
1.55,
1.9,
2.0];
floor:朝迟磨负无穷方向靠近最近的整数;
floor(A)
ans
=
-2
-2
-2
-2
-2
1
1
1
1
1
2
ceil:朝正无穷方向靠近最近的整帆旦握数;
ceil(A)
ans
=
-2
-1
-1
-1
-1
1
2
2
2
2
2
round:取最近的整数(相当于四舍五入)
round(A)
ans
=
-2
-2
-2
-1
-1
1
1
1
2
2
2
fix:取离0最近的整数
fix(A)
ans
=
-2
-1
-1
-1
-1
1
1
1
1
1
2
matlab做除法,怎么取整数?
方法一:
floor(a/b);就是舍去小数点。
ceil(a/b)就是舍去枣基小数点+1的数。
方法二:
fix(x)截尾取整
fix(x)不超过x的最大整数
ceil(x)大凳慎谨于x的最小孝李整数
round(x)四舍五入取整
扩展资料:
Matlab常用函数和命令
sqrt 平方根
sqrtm 方根矩阵
squeeze 删去大小为1的"孤维"
surface 创建面对象
surfc 带等位线的表面图
surfl 带光照的三维表面图
surfnorm 空间表面的法线
loglog: x轴和y轴均为对数刻度(Logarithmic scale)
semilogx: x轴为对数刻度,y轴为线性刻度
semilogy: x轴为线性刻度,y轴为对数刻度
sym2poly 符号多项式转变为双精度多项式系数向量
参考资料来源:百度百科-MATLAB
matlab中fix()干什么用的
FIX(X) rounds the elements of X to the nearest integers towards zero.向0靠拢取整,例:
fix(3.2)ans =3 fix(3.7)ans =3 fix(-3.7)ans =-3 fix(-3.2)ans =-3
MATLAB中取整函数fix, floor, ceil, round)的使用
MATLAB取整函数
1)fix(x) : 截尾取整. fix( [3.12 -3.12]) ans = 3 -3
(2)floor(x):不超过旁如肆x 的最大整数.(高斯取整) floor( [3.12 -3.12]) ans = 3 -4
(3)ceil(x) : 大于x 的最小整数 ceil( [3.12 -3.12]) ans = 4 -3
(4)四舍五入取整 round(3.12 -3.12) ans = 0 橡睁 round([3.12 -3.12]) ans = 3 -3
MATLAB中四个取整函数具体使用方法如下:
Matlab取整函数有: fix, floor, ceil, round. fix 朝零方向取整,如fix(-1.3)=-1; fix(1.3)=1; floor 朝负无穷方向取整,如floor(-1.3)=-2; floor(1.3)=1; ceil 朝正无穷方向取整,如ceil(-1.3)=-1; ceil(1.3)=2; round 四舍五入到最近运轿的整数,如round(-1.3)=-1;round(-1.52)=-2;round(1.3)=1;round(1.52)=2
中文名称:吞吐量,英文名称:
throughput
定义:对网络、设备、端口、虚电路或其他设施,单位时间内成功地传送数据的数量(以比特、字节、分组等测量)。吞吐量是指在没有帧丢失的情况下,设备能够接受并转发的最大数据速率。
MATLAB中取整用什么函数
1、floor 向下取整
a=1.4;
b=floor(a)
b = 1
2、ceil向上取整
b=ceil(a)
b = 2
3、fix向零取整
a=[-1.9,1.9];
b=fix(a)
b = -1 1
4、round 四舍五入取整
a=[0.4 0.5];
b=round(a)
b = 0 1
扩展资料:
一、优势特点
1、高效的数值计算及符号计算功能,能使用户从繁杂的数学运算分析中解脱出来;
2、具有完备的图形处理功能,拍御实现计算结果和编程的可视化;
3、友好的用户界面及接近数学表达式的自然化语言,使学者易于学习和掌握;
4、功能丰富的应用工具箱(如信号处理工具箱、通信工具箱等) ,为用户提供了大量方便携衡实用的处理工具。
二、开发环境
MATLAB开发环境是一套方便用户使用的MATLAB函数和文件工具集,其中许多工具是图形化用户接口。它是一个集成的 用户工作空间,允许用户输入输出数据,并提供了M文件的集成编译和调试环境,包括MATLAB桌面、命令窗口、M文件编辑调试器、MATLAB工作空间和在线帮助文档。
三、数学函数
MATLAB数学函数库包括了大量的计算算法。从基本算法如四则运算、三角函数,到复杂算法如矩阵求逆、快速傅里叶变辩贺做换等。
参考资料来源:百度百科-MATLAB
MATLAB:取整、取余函数
取厅谈整函数:
向正方向取整:ceil
向负方向取整:floor
向0方向取整:fix
四舍五入取整:round
取余函数:
rem(x,y)=x-y.*fix(x./y)
mod(x,y)=x-y.*fix(x./y)
当x,y同号时, rem(x,y)与mod(x,y)相同
当x,y异号时世雹,rem(x,y)值的符号与x一致扮返碰,mod(x,y)值的符号与y一致
关于matlab取整函数和matlab中的取整函数的介绍到此就结束了,记得收藏关注本站。